The ingredients needed to make The Lazy Cake:
  1. Take 1 pack Strawberry pudding
  2. Prepare 1 pack chocolate pudding
  3. Make ready 250 grams sponge cake, shop Brought or homemade
  4. Prepare sprinkles

Instructions to make The Lazy Cake:
  1. Prepare the strawberry pudding, following the packet instructions. Let it cool completely.
  2. Prepare the sponge if you are going to make your own and let it cool completely.
  3. Then cut the sponge to about 1 cm thick and layer it until the strawberry is covered completely.
  4. Prepare the chocolate pudding following the packet instructions and layer the sponge with the pudding.
  5. Let it set for the required time.
  6. Cover the top with sprinkles just before serving.
  7. You can also add whipped cream then top with chocolate shavings or any kind of topping you prefer.
  8. Ready to serve and ENJOY!
